Palmer faced Juneau-Douglas in a battle between two of the state's top teams on Saturday. The Moose put the hurt on the Crimson Bears with a sharp 41-20 victory. The score was close at halftime, but the Moose pulled away in the second half with 20 points.
Corbin Gerkin had an outrageously good game as he rushed for 174 yards and three TDs while picking up 7.3 yards per carry. Reed Craner was in the mix as well, providing Palmer with two touchdowns.
Palmer now has a winning record of 2-1. As for Juneau-Douglas, their defeat dropped their record down to 1-2.
Both squads will have to hit the road in their upcoming games. Palmer will face off against West Valley at 7:00 p.m. on Saturday. As for Juneau-Douglas, they will challenge Bartlett at 2:00 p.m. on Saturday.
